Output 50bf7f71f530afd87aa8021376a058eab9a1dbb8f664cfc7dcb18c40fb480e23:1

value
500000
script pubkey
OP_0 OP_PUSHBYTES_32 30db126ae88377c90c984bada728d95945c69e98123893cedf71c8b6a80cc126
address
bc1qxrd3y6hgsdmujrycfwk6w2xet9zud85czguf8nklw8ytd2qvcynq4yd2fq
transaction
50bf7f71f530afd87aa8021376a058eab9a1dbb8f664cfc7dcb18c40fb480e23
confirmations
195388
spent
true